Output dd30054eb2040d8a608e0e6cfcff4fc9b8fb1363dd798e3f67a7acf44751c14e:36

value
200000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e6d218e6a651c090582af5d75d22ad0df2fad62 OP_EQUAL
address
3QtJHq32K1ixxs6gdwGtLhFxefshHXPfpa
transaction
dd30054eb2040d8a608e0e6cfcff4fc9b8fb1363dd798e3f67a7acf44751c14e
spent
true